I have a strange issue at work where there are a few people who, when they
open certain documents, it takes a minute or more to open the file. We have
profiles set up here, and can log in at any computer. For one of the people,
we tried creating a new profile, but that didn't help. I'm using the old
profile though for testing, and when I logged on at my computer, and opened
the file, it took the usual minute or more to open. But, when I opened the
same file logged in as me, it opened right up, with maybe a slight hicough.
I can't think of anything that would do this, and I can't find anything
either. It has to be something in the profile that does it, but I'm not sure
what. Any thoughts?
 
Does this happen if the user, logged in, creates and saves a new document,
then tries to open it?

I suspect not. If not, look at
http://support.microsoft.com/?kbid=830561 "Documents that
have attached templates take a long time to open in Word 2002 and
in Word 2003"
